Roof Shingles Replacement in Middlesex County, NJ
Property owners in Middlesex County NJ can benefit from professional roof shingle replacement to address damage from weather or aging. Replacing worn or broken shingles helps prevent leaks, enhances curb appeal, and extends the roof's lifespan. Expert assessment ensures the right materials and proper installation for long-term protection.